
"The leak comes from the Kingdom Come: Deliverance's PlayStation Store page. A Reddit user spotted new text in the game's description on the storefront, that referred to a PS5 version and its accompanying enhancements. The new text, which seems to have been updated on the PlayStation Store page ahead of schedule, has now been deleted. However, screenshots of the description section reveal that Warhorse Studios is readying an updated current-gen version of its RPG for the PS5 and presumable Xbox Series S/X consoles."
"(Re)discover Henry's saga, from the start," the additional text reads, as per the screenshot shared on X. "Experience Kingdom Come: Deliverance, the iconic story-driven open-world RPG set in medieval Bohemia." An additional text paragraph, titled "Updated for PlayStation 5", details the updates that will come with the PS5 version of the game. "The PS5 version of Kingdom Come: Deliverance now features graphical updates including 4K resolution, improved framerate, high-resolution textures and many more. Medieval Bohemia has never been so beautiful."
A PlayStation Store listing briefly displayed an updated PlayStation 5 entry for Kingdom Come: Deliverance describing graphical enhancements and performance improvements. Screenshots captured by users showed text referencing a native PS5 version and suggested a forthcoming Xbox Series S/X release. The updated description mentioned 4K resolution, improved framerate, high-resolution textures, and other graphical upgrades. The listing text was later removed and the storefront now shows only the original description and features. Warhorse Studios has not issued an official announcement. The game remains available on PC, PS4, and Xbox One, and runs on PS5 and Xbox Series consoles with previous-gen performance settings.
